Manchester city council has approved Allied London’s plans for the redevelopment of the former Granada Television headquarters and studios.
The Levitt Bernstein-designed plans include a 150-bedroom hotel, 45,000 sq ft of restaurants and bars and 45,000 sq ft of offices.
It is part of the 13-acre St John’s Quarter regeneration scheme, which will include offices, 1,450 homes and cultural amenities.
Deloitte Real Estate is advising on planning.
